The tuition for UWO is wrong. It was about $18700/year. Calgary is around $19 000 as well. I assume the rest of the universities are also higher than posted.
The reason for international tuition being so much is the cost of medical training for one doctor is in the ballpark of $300,000 to $400,000 - partly due to subsidized tuition and the cost of residency. Why would the Canadian government want to invest in an international student* who may return to their own country after their medical training. Also, McMaster is all-year round meaning you're paying for the cost of three terms instead of two. For American schools you can expect to pay around $50 000 per tuition (2 terms, 1 year), so it's comparable.
*Even if you're considered an international student during undergrad, you may be considered an Ontario Resident for doing school during this time. Not 100% sure about whether you pay international or regular tuition.
